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ol (DHCP) is a client/server protocol that automatically provides an Internet Protocol (IP) host with its IP address and other related configuration information such as the subnet mask and default gateway. WebNov 19, 2015 · To expand the address pool, right-click on the scope in the left column and choose Properties (you can't do it directly from the Address Pool window). To add exclusions, right-click on Address Pool in the left column and choose "New Exclusion Range". Also, there's no need to convert your static IPs to dynamic.

I have created another scope with the below: 10.141.82.1-10.141.83.254 /23 but it is not working. we are using a Windows Server 2024. dictatorial power meaningWebSep 16, 2010 · At the DHCP server, click Start, point to Administrative Tools, and then click DHCP. In the console tree, right-click the scope you want to extend, and then click Properties.
